2.8.3 Functions of the User Mode
Card Count
Indicates the current card count and is used to monitor card production. Pressing the
Clear key resets the value to 0.
Total Count
Indicates the total number of cards printed and cannot be reset. This value helps give the
operator a measure of the printer’s overall work cycle.
Color Adjustment
Setting allows the user to adjust the intensity of Yellow, Magenta and Cyan. Each value
can be adjusted with the range of ±3.
Black Adjustment
Increase the value for a more crisp fine line or decrease the value if a bold line smudges.
Error Buzzer
Selection is either on/off. An audible alarm sounds when errors such as “Cover Open” or
“Card Empty” occur if the selection is turned on.
Ribbon Type
Select the appropriate ribbon type – refer to the label on the ribbon and the various ribbon
types. See Chapter 2.3: Loading The Ribbon on page 9. Setting the appropriate ribbon
type is required for proper operation.
SCSI ID Select
Select the appropriate SCSI ID. See Chapter 2.4.1: SCSI Connection on page 12.
ROM Version – Optional Devices
If an encoder ROM display is included in the ROM version menu, an internal encoder is
connected. If no encoder is installed, this display will be blank.
ROM Version – Optional Encoder Type
4 digit alpha-numeric value displayed on the lower right side of the “encoder ROM”
which shows the type of the encoder connected.
ROM Version – Firmware Version Information
The printer’s current firmware version. The firmware version can be updated in order to
support additional controls. See Chapter 3.8: Updating The Firmware on page 27.
Printer Status – System Environment
Set these functions according to the system being used.
MENU FUNCTION
Parity Set Set On/Off for the parity.
Encode Type Select Hi-Co or Low-Co.
Encode First When set to on, encoding is done before printing.
Encode Mode Determines encoding orientation.
Encode Reject Selects rejected hopper.
